Memleak in IsOptionMember
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
imagemagick (Debian) |
Fix Released
|
Unknown
|
|||
imagemagick (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
The ImageMagick version shipped with Ubuntu 16.04 (version 8:6.8.9.
http://
So I request this fix to be backported to 16.04 (and other affect version, if applicable; 14.04 is not affected).
The tool ODR-PadEnc which I maintain is affected by the bug:
https:/
Here one of the outputs that Valgrind procudes for each invokation - in this case, I used 14.04 with http://
==1961== 455,322 bytes in 111 blocks are definitely lost in loss record 1,761 of 1,762
==1961== at 0x4C2AB80: malloc (in /usr/lib/
==1961== by 0x5E2DB3E: AcquireString (string.c:132)
==1961== by 0x5E2FC10: StringToArgv (string.c:2196)
==1961== by 0x5DC46F7: IsOptionMember (option.c:2278)
==1961== by 0x5F3F789: WritePNGImage (png.c:11996)
==1961== by 0x5D12B11: WriteImage (constitute.c:1184)
==1961== by 0x5CDE340: ImageToBlob (blob.c:1607)
==1961== by 0x40D7A5: SLSManager:
==1961== by 0x4038B1: main (odr-padenc.
Changed in imagemagick (Ubuntu): | |
status: | New → In Progress |
Changed in imagemagick (Debian): | |
status: | Unknown → Fix Released |
tags: | added: xenial |
Changed in imagemagick (Ubuntu): | |
status: | In Progress → Fix Released |